First, let’s delve into the existing color psychology of the rose:

1. **Red Roses**: The quintessential expression of passionate love, red roses serve as the universal symbol for romance. Historically, they were also gifted by soldiers to signify their appreciation of their loved ones during wartime. Today, this vibrant hue remains front and center, a steadfast beacon for conveying one’s strongest romantic sentiments.

2. **Pink Roses**: Pink roses bring the warmth of affection and admiration. Often seen as a more gentle or tender form of love, this soft color offers reassurance and a promise of loyalty. Pink roses are making a comeback, representing the softer, more personal side of romance.

3. **White Roses**: Representing innocence, purity, and new beginnings, white roses are commonly associated with wedding ceremonies and the start of a new chapter in life. An enduring symbol, white roses continue to serve as an excellent gift for those looking to share a message of respect and reverence.

4. **Orange Roses**: Combining energy and warmth, these roses symbolize desire and enthusiasm, making them an engaging option for those looking to infuse their romantic expression with both passion and playfulness.

5. **Yellow Roses**: Offering a sunny disposition, yellow roses convey joy and friendship. They’re also frequently associated with gratitude, which has been timely in recent years as the idea of thanking loved ones takes on a more appreciated place in contemporary relationships.

As these colors represent the core psychological concepts connected to the rose, the landscape is seeing several new trends:

**1. Personalized Rose Colors**: With the increasing power of personalization, rose breeders are creating new colors that blend existing hues, giving customers a broader spectrum of meaning. For instance, a rose with a mix of pink and white could represent a blend of romance and purity with newness.

**2. Nature-Inspired Shades**: In a world increasingly sensitive to environmental concerns, there’s a growing trend of creating roses that mimic the subtleties found in nature, such as peach or lavender hues. These colors can evoke a romantic connection that’s more reflective of the earth itself.

**3. Textured Gardens**: Beyond the color of the roses, recent trends show a movement toward creating gardens that tell a story. This includes incorporating multi-colored roses to create patterns in the garden. Such an approach allows the rose to become a character within larger themes, deepening the psychological undercurrents of the garden as a romantic setting.

**4. Seasonal Themes**: Color trends within the rose palette are aligning with seasonal motifs. For example, autumnal colors like rust and amber may pair well with certain rose types, offering romanticism in harmony with the changing seasons.
